How Were the Sawtooth Mountains Formed?

The Sawtooth Mountains, a stunning mountain range located in central Idaho, United States, have intrigued geologists and nature enthusiasts alike. Their unique, jagged peaks resemble the teeth of a saw, hence their name. But how were the Sawtooth Mountains formed?

The formation of the Sawtooth Mountains is a result of millions of years of geological activity. The region is situated along the North American tectonic plate, which is constantly moving. This movement has led to the uplift and folding of the Earth’s crust, creating the mountain range we see today.

Around 50 million years ago, the North American tectonic plate began to push against the Juan de Fuca plate, an oceanic plate off the coast of the Pacific Northwest. This collision caused the Earth’s crust to buckle and fold, forming the initial structure of the Sawtooth Mountains. Over time, the mountains have been shaped by erosion, weathering, and glacial activity.

One of the key factors in the formation of the Sawtooth Mountains is the glacial activity that occurred during the last ice age. Glaciers carved out the distinctive peaks and valleys, creating the jagged, saw-like appearance of the mountains. The melting of these glaciers also contributed to the creation of numerous lakes and rivers in the region.

The Sawtooth Mountains are also home to a diverse range of plant and animal life. The rugged terrain and varying elevations provide a habitat for various species, including elk, deer, and mountain goats. The region’s unique geological history has played a significant role in shaping its natural environment.

In conclusion, the Sawtooth Mountains were formed through a combination of tectonic plate movement, uplift, folding, and glacial activity. This geological process has created a stunning mountain range that is both visually captivating and biologically diverse.
